Add trigger-cron endpoint + optimize dockerfile for server

This commit is contained in:
David Dworken
2022-04-16 16:28:53 -07:00
parent ab04756bab
commit 05f1af8714
2 changed files with 26 additions and 8 deletions

View File

@@ -1,8 +1,10 @@
FROM golang:1.17
FROM golang:1.17 AS builder
COPY go.mod ./
COPY go.sum ./
RUN unset GOPATH; go mod download
COPY . ./
RUN unset GOPATH; go build -o /server -ldflags "-X main.ReleaseVersion=v0.`cat VERSION`" backend/server/server.go
CMD [ "/server" ]
FROM golang:1.17
COPY --from=builder /server /server
CMD ["/server"]